First Impressions

Walking up to Stylishly large Camden apartment B1 on Eversholt Street, you know you’re getting something different from the usual hotel experience. This three-star apartment sits right in the heart of Camden, and honestly, the location couldn’t be better if you’re planning to explore North London properly. The building itself is typical London residential — nothing fancy from the outside, but that’s kind of the point.

The Space Itself

Once you’re inside, the “stylishly large” part of the name makes perfect sense. The room genuinely feels spacious by London standards, which — let’s be honest — isn’t always saying much, but this one actually delivers. You’ve got a proper kitchen setup that’s not just for show, meaning you can actually cook a decent meal instead of surviving on takeaways for your entire stay. The furnishings lean modern without trying too hard, and there’s enough storage space that you won’t be living out of your suitcase.

Camden Neighborhood

What I really appreciate about this spot is how it puts you right in the thick of Camden without the tourist trap nonsense. Eversholt Street runs parallel to the main Camden High Street chaos, so you get the energy without the constant noise. You’re a five-minute walk from Camden Market when you want the full experience, but you can also duck into proper local pubs and grab groceries at the Sainsbury’s just down the road. The Tube connections are solid too — Euston and King’s Cross are both walkable, which means you can get anywhere in London without much fuss.

Practical Details

The apartment works well for people who want to feel settled rather than just passing through. Having that functional kitchen means you can start your day with proper coffee instead of whatever passes for breakfast at nearby cafés (though honestly, some of them are pretty good). There’s decent natural light, the WiFi actually works reliably, and you won’t hear every conversation from the neighboring rooms like you do in some London places. The bathroom’s nothing special, but it’s clean and has decent water pressure — sometimes that’s all you need.

Why It Works

Look, this isn’t going to wow you with fancy amenities or concierge service, but that’s not really the point. It’s for people who want to experience Camden like they actually live there, not like they’re just visiting. The three-star rating feels about right — comfortable and well-maintained without any pretense. You’re paying for the location and the space, and in that regard, it delivers exactly what it promises. If you want to explore Camden’s music scene, check out the markets, or just use it as a base for London adventures, this place gives you room to breathe and settle in properly.
